What size solar panel do I need to run a 12v fridge?

The best size solar panel for running a 12-volt fridge is 150-watts, with a 200-watt battery. In order to use your fridge during the night, energy produced by your panel during the daylight must be stored in a battery. 150-watts is large enough to ensure you are covered in the event of a cloudy day.

How many solar panels does it take to run a Dometic fridge?

If your refrigerator will consume 30 Amp-hours per day, you should have battery storage of 90 Amp-hours and a solar panel of 80 watt or greater to make sure you don’t have problems.
